Sinking In


Fighting a sink clog automatically suggests obtaining a shower room plunger. In picking a bettor, ensure it has a huge sufficient suction cup that can entirely conceal the drain. It should additionally have the ability to produce an airtight seal around the surrounding sink. Next off, you must fill the component to entirely cover the plunger's suction cup. Do this by utilizing water or finish the cup's rim with oil jelly. You ought to develop a vacuum by trying to seal other outlets, like overflow drain in sinks. After that, push out any type of caught air below the mug. After this, do 15 to 20 strong up-and-down pumping strikes to jerk loosened the blockage. It may take you 3 to five times of this cycle to do the method. Snake It Out If making use of the plunger does not work, after that you would need to resort to another strategy. In this remedy, you would certainly need to have a plumbing snake. You can get one at your neighborhood hardware. These can function their way with your drainpipe pipes and also physically push out the blockages. Plumbing serpents are thought about to be among the most reliable devices for dealing with drainage troubles. All you need to do is push the snake in up until you struck the clog. When you hit the blockage, hook it up by turning your snake's deal with. After hooking it up, press your snake backward and forward up until you really feel that the obstruction has separated. After that, flush out the pipeline making use of cold water. Main Drain Clean-up If you identify that more than one of your draining pipes components is blocked, then your primary drainpipe line might be the trouble. Hence, you need to clean it up. You can start off by finding the clean-out plugs of the big drainpipe pipelines. You can find these in your crawlspace or basement. Main drainpipe lines can additionally be found in your garage or somewhere outside, along the structures of your residence. You can see that each plug has a cap on it that has a square installation on the top. Use a wrench to remove the cap. Ensure that you have a container with you to capture some trickling water. Also, make certain that no one will certainly use the facilities while you the main drainpipe line is open, otherwise some serious problem can come your way. When you have whatever in position, use a plumbing serpent to separate any kind of blockages in the main line by running the snake in all directions of the pipe.

Be Vigilant


One method to deal with significant plumbing problems is by prevention. Keeping an eagle eye for slow-moving or slow drains is the secret. It is way much easier to take care of and also unclog a sluggish drain than opening one that has completely stopped from working. If your drain is sluggish, you can fix this by simply pouring scalding water down the pipeline. Do this to loosen up any kind of oil accumulation. Furthermore, you ought to clean up the drain screen or stopper. This ought to work. Nevertheless, if it does not, then try to locate the problem by having a look at other house drains pipes. Do this to recognize whether the blockage exists in only one fixture. If it ends up that drains are clogged, then you may have an issue with your main drain pipeline.

Dispose of Leftovers Properly


Another common issue during the holidays is drains getting clogged with food scraps. To avoid this, dispose of all food properly in the garbage or keep leftovers in the fridge. A few foods that you should never let go down your drain or garbage disposal include:


  • Grease and oil


  • Meat bones


  • Stringy vegetables


  • Potato peels


  • Coffee grounds


  • Eggshells


  • Wait a Few Minutes in Between Showers


    Taking too many showers in a short period of time can lead to decreased water pressure and lukewarm to cold water temperatures. If you have several family members or friends staying with you during the holidays, make sure to space out showers to avoid any problems and give your water heater time to replenish.


    Take Care of Your Toilet


    The toilet is one of the most used plumbing fixtures in the home, so it’s important to take care of it, especially during the holidays. One of the last things anyone wants to deal with during a holiday dinner is a clogged toilet, so make sure your guests know not to treat your toilet like a trash can. Avoid flushing anything other than human waste and toilet paper down the toilet.
